﻿body {background: white; font-family: Verdana, Helvetica, Arial; font-size: smaller; color: Gray}
h1 { font-size: large; margin: 0; padding: 0 0 8px 0; font-weight: normal }
h2 { font-size: small; margin: 0; padding: 0 0 5px 0;}
hr { clear: both; height: 0; border: 0; border-bottom: dotted 2px Gray; margin:15px 0 0 0 }
a { color: #00a3da}
a:hover { color: red}

#page       { margin: 0 auto; width: 950px;}
#header     { height: 120px }
#ccy_select	{ float: right }
#logo       { float: left; width: 370px; height: 120px; border: 0}
#tabs       { float: right; margin: 70px 0 0 0; font-size: .75em; height: 30px }
#tabs li { list-style-type:none;} 
.tab_off    { background-image: url("/images/tab_off.gif"); width: 85px; height: 23px; 
              float: left; text-align: center; margin-left: 5px; padding-top:7px}
.tab_off a  { color: Gray; text-decoration: none; font-weight: bold }
.tab_off a:hover  { color: #00a3da }
.tab_on     { background-image: url("/images/tab_on.gif"); width: 85px; height: 23px; 
              float: left; text-align: center; margin-left: 5px; padding-top:7px}
.tab_on a   { color: White; text-decoration: none; font-weight: bold }
#topbanner  { height: 220px; position: relative; }
#sidenav    { background-image: url("/images/sidenav_bg.gif"); position: absolute; left: 0; top: 0; width: 200px; height: 210px; 
              margin: 0; padding: 10px 0 0 15px; font-size: 1.1em; line-height: 1.5; color: White; font-weight: bold }
#sidenav li { list-style-type:none;}   
#sidenav a  { color: #3c3e3e; text-decoration: none; font-weight: normal }
#sidenav a:hover  { color: White; text-decoration: none }
#banner     { position: absolute; left: 215px; top: 0; width: 735px}
#main       { clear: both; margin: 15px 0 0 0 }
#leftcol    { float: left; width: 215px; color: White}
#leftcol a  { color: Yellow; font-weight: bold; text-decoration: none; font-size: smaller }
#leftcol a:hover { text-decoration: underline }
#leftcol_top        { background-color: #36a7e9; background-image: url("/images/leftside_top.gif"); background-repeat:no-repeat; width: 215px; height: 6px}
#leftcol_content    { background-color: #36a7e9; padding: 12px}
#leftcol_content hr, #rightcol_content hr { border-bottom: dotted 2px White; margin: 5px 0 5px 0}
#leftcol_bottom     { background-image: url("/images/leftside_bottom.gif"); background-repeat:no-repeat; width: 215px; height: 6px}
#rightcol           { float: right; width: 215px; color: #3c3e3e;}
#rightcol a  { color: White; font-weight: bold; text-decoration: none; font-size: smaller }
#rightcol a:hover { text-decoration: underline }
#rightcol_top       { background-image: url("/images/rightside_top.gif"); width: 215px; height: 6px}
#rightcol_content   { background-color: #d6d6d6; padding: 12px}
#rightcol_content h1, #rightcol_content h2 { color: White }
#rightcol_bottom    { background-image: url("/images/rightside_bottom.gif"); width: 215px; height: 6px}
#content    { float: left; width: 50%; padding: 20px}
#content h1 { color: #00a3da; }
#content img { float: left; padding: 0 10px 10px 0 }

#footer     { clear: both; text-align:center; font-size: smaller}
#footer a { color: Gray; text-decoration: none; font-weight:bold }
#footer a:hover {color: #00a3da; text-decoration: underline}
.promotion { border-top: dashed 1px Gray; clear: both; padding: 15px 0 15px 0; font-size: .9em }
.promotion a  { color: #3c3e3e; font-weight: bold; text-decoration: none; font-size: smaller }
.promotion a:hover { text-decoration: underline }
#leftcol_content .promotion, #rightcol_content .promotion { border: 0; border-bottom: dashed 1px White}



